	<title><![CDATA[SIMBA: a Genome Assembly Project Management System]]></title>
	<description><![CDATA[<p><span>SIMBA</span><span>, SImple Manager for Bacterial Assemblies, is a Web interface for managing assembly projects of bacterial genomes. SIMBA was created to assist bioinformaticians to assemble bacterial genomes sequenced with NextGeneration Sequencing (NGS) platforms quickly, easily and effectively. SIMBA also is open source tool, i.e., can be freely downloaded, shared and modified.</span></p><p>Address of the bookmark: <a href="http://ufmg-simba.sourceforge.net/" rel="nofollow">http://ufmg-simba.sourceforge.net/</a></p>]]></description>

	<title><![CDATA[regioneR: an R package for the management and comparison of genomic regions]]></title>
	<description><![CDATA[<p><span>Regioner is an R package for the management and comparison of genomic regions. It offers a set of function for basic manipulation of region sets extending the functionality of GenomicRanges and a powerful and customizable permutation test framework. With it, it's possible to study the association of a set of regions with other sets of regions, functions defined over the genome or essentially any user defined function.</span></p>

	<title><![CDATA[Mesquite: A modular system for evolutionary analysis]]></title>
	<description><![CDATA[<p><span>Mesquite is modular, extendible software for evolutionary biology, designed to help biologists organize and analyze comparative data about organisms. Its emphasis is on phylogenetic analysis, but some of its modules concern population genetics, while others do non-phylogenetic multivariate analysis. Because it is modular, the analyses available depend on the modules installed.</span></p>

	<title><![CDATA[Taverna Workflow Management System]]></title>
	<description><![CDATA[<p>Taverna is an open source domain independent Workflow Management System &ndash; a suite of tools used to design and execute scientific workflows. Taverna has been created by the myGrid project and is funded through a range of organisations and projects.</p>
<p>The Taverna suite is written in Java and includes the Taverna Engine(used for enacting workflows) that powers both the Taverna Workbench(the desktop client application) and the Taverna Server (which allows remote execution of workflows). Taverna is also available as a Command Line Tool for a quick execution of workflows from a terminal.</p><p>Address of the bookmark: <a href="http://www.taverna.org.uk/" rel="nofollow">http://www.taverna.org.uk/</a></p>]]></description>

	<title><![CDATA[Breedbase is a comprehensive breeding management and analysis software]]></title>
	<description><![CDATA[<p><span>Breedbase is a comprehensive breeding management and analysis software. It can be used to design field layouts, collect phenotypic information using tablets, support the collection of genotyping samples in a field, store large amounts of high density genotypic information, and provide Genomic Selection related analyses and predictions. Breedbase supports the BrAPI standard.</span></p><p>Address of the bookmark: <a href="https://breedbase.org/" rel="nofollow">https://breedbase.org/</a></p>]]></description>

	<title><![CDATA[A quick guide to Phred scaling]]></title>
	<description><![CDATA[<p>A quick guide to Phred scaling<br /><br />&bull; Phred value = &minus;10 * log10(&epsilon;)<br /><br />&bull; Examples:<br />&bull; 90% confidence (10% error rate) = Q10<br />&bull; 99% confidence (1% error rate) = Q20<br />&bull; 99.9% confidence (.1% error rate) = Q30<br /><br />&bull; SAM encoding adds 33 to the value (because<br />ASCII 33 is the first visible character)</p>]]></description>
